Transaction 37286810385eb57a9fdc0ef03787e66a174e66cdecb1402c536b0a8b1bf9959c
1 Input
1 Output
-
37286810385eb57a9fdc0ef03787e66a174e66cdecb1402c536b0a8b1bf9959c:0
- value
- 430017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 150b8bf8bc7ec4cf151e4c3543fe8f15a5fb9285 OP_EQUAL
- address
- 33cHwrZvfGSyrCQkCu4cYFAYJqCTHRZWi2